Low Ground and Spring Melt

Much of East Kildonan sits on low ground close to the river. Spring melt saturates the clay soil, and that saturation persists, pressing water against foundation walls for weeks.

Older foundations offer more paths in. Water finds hairline cracks, mortar joints, and the seam where wall meets floor. In an unfinished basement you would see it. In a finished one, it soaks into drywall and framing behind the finishing and does its work unseen.

That is the usual basement mould call from this area: no visible water, a persistent musty smell, and affected material found once a section of wall comes off.

Before You Finish a Basement

If you are planning to finish a basement in East Kildonan, checking moisture conditions first is worth the small cost. Foundation seepage that is manageable while the basement is bare becomes a considerably more expensive problem once it is behind new drywall and insulation.

A mould inspection at that stage is really a moisture assessment, and it tells you what needs correcting before finishing rather than after.

Older Housing Materials

The area’s substantial pre-1980s housing means asbestos testing is relevant to most renovation work here. Vinyl floor tile and its mastic, textured ceilings, and pipe wrap in basements all appear regularly.

Basement renovation is where the two concerns intersect most: the same project that addresses moisture often disturbs the older materials down there.
